Ship talk

Some odd snippets of over heard conversation....going through a crowded lounge this morning a voice boomed out
"Good morning vicar." It was the wine waiter who has seen my card and drawn his own conclusions...
Lady next to me in the Commodore club.
"I don’t know why this phones not working"
"How old is it? "
"I don’t know....not that old ...I’ve only had it ten years."
Later
"What are we doing today? "
"We can’t go ashore."
"Why not? "
"Because there’s only one way of doing it and it’s by using another boat."
I am not sure about this place....
Why not?
It’s a bit cut off.
My daughter liked it.
Well that’s no recommendation.
I do try not to listen but sometimes you just can’t help it.
"You mean you actually like Trump?"
"Sure....he’ll get it done you know." Not sure what he’s going to get done but some of the people on this ship regard him as an absolute hero. The other half apologise for him...This takes up a lot of listening time.
I am now more of a listener and spectator than a doer...but that is all good. Most of the people I’ve got to know so far are getting off in New York. It could be a lonely journey home to Southampton.
